Manchester United suffered their first defeat since the 1-0 loss against Southampton in January after losing 2-1 to Swansea this weekend. It has increased the difference between United and table leaders Chelsea, but Manchester United boss van Gaal felt that his team were unlucky not to get something from the match.
He said that a dominant performance from his team was not rewarded with even a single point. Ironically, it was Swansea who managed to beat United on the opening day of the season. This defeat brought an immediate end to the positive mood surrounding the club after the appointment of Van Gaal.
It has taken the Dutchman several months in order to get the club go on a consistent run. Since the last Manchester derby in November, United have been beaten only twice. And this form and could potentially see them into the top three without any trouble. United were helped by the fact that Southampton, who are their nearest rivals in the top three race, also suffered a defeat this weekend. read more
